WebThere’s a set amount you can claim for preparation time. The amount increases every year. The current rate is £41 an hour. So if you spent 10 hours preparing your case, you could ask for a preparation time order for 10 x £41, which is £410. You should make this figure part of the claim you present to your employer. WebMar 21, 2024 · Making a claim to an employment tribunal (T420) 3 June 2024 Guidance Your claim - what happens next (T421) 7 January 2024 Guidance Responding to a claim … WebEmployment tribunals deal with claims brought against employers by employees. Claims can typically relate to unfair and wrongful dismissals, discrimination, equal pay, and deductions from wage deductions. Employees must contact Acas first to try to resolve the dispute through early conciliation.

The tribunal must receive a claim within 3 months minus 1 day from the date of the first act (s) you are complaining about. For example, in an unfair dismissal claim it would be three months from the date of your dismissal. Employment Tribunals are independent judicial bodies who resolve disputes between employers and employees over employment rights. They will hear claims such as unfair dismissal, breach of contract, discrimination, unlawful deductions from wages, and redundancy payments, amongst others. 2. crazy mobile homesWebThere are strict time limits for making a claim to an employment tribunal. If you're thinking about making a claim, the first step is to notify Acas. You should do this within your time limit. You have either: 3 months minus 1 day – for most claims 6 months minus 1 day – for claims about statutory redundancy pay or equal pay only maize pollination
